Tokens in Command Buffer
ZSPI-TKN-MANAGER
is a standard SPI token that is optional for SNAX/APC. In other subsystems, this
token contains the process name; however, for SNAX/APC, object names include
the SNAX/APC process name, so this token is not necessary.
ZCOM-TKN-OBJNAME
is a standard data communications token that identifies the object name and the
SNAX/APC process name. SNAX/APC object names have the format
$
snax/apc-process-name
.
object-name
. This token is required. Refer to
Section 3, “Elements of SPI Messages for SNAX/APC,” and Section 4, “Common
Definitions,” for further information on object names.
ZCOM-TKN-CMD-TIMEOUT
is a standard data communications token described in the SPI Common Extensions
Manual.
ZCOM-TKN-SEL-SUMSTATE
indicates that the command applies only to objects in a specific summary state.
Refer to Section 3, “Elements of SPI Messages for SNAX/APC,” for further
information on summary states.
ZCOM-TKN-SUB
indicates whether the command affects the specified object, its subordinate objects,
or both. Refer to Section 3, “Elements of SPI Messages for SNAX/APC,” and
Section 4, “Common Definitions,” for further information on subordinate objects
and the SUB token.
(ZSPI-TKN-)MAXRESP, CONTEXT, and ALLOW-TYPE
are standard SPI tokens described in the SPI Programming Manual.
